EO 14,217: Commencing the Reduction of the Federal Bureaucracy
Executive Order | February 19, 2025
This Executive Order (EO) stated that the policy of the Trump Administration was to greatly decrease the size of the bureaucracy while increasing accountability. It directed the elimination of several small agencies and advisory committees, including: the Presidio Trust, the Inter-American Foundation, the United States African Development Foundation, and the United States Institute of Peace. The EO also terminated the Presidential Management Fellows Program, a leadership development program at the entry-level for advanced degree candidates, which had been created decades prior. The EO also directed administration officials to identify other agencies and committees to eliminate.
